Contact information
![]() |
SF Show Room
1605 Noriega Street Business Hours:
Mon-Fri, 9:30 a.m. – 6:00 p.m. Sat-Sun, 10:00 a.m. – 5:00 p.m.
|
![]() |
Millbrae Show Room
1145 El Camino Real Business Hours:
Mon-Fri, 9:30 a.m. – 6:00 p.m.
Sat-Sun, 10:00 a.m. – 5:00 p.m. |